Isaac Schmidt suffers injury while on Switzerland duty

Isaac Schmidt was loaned out by Leeds in the latter stages of the summer, as he joined Werder Bremen on a season-long loan deal.

Things had been looking up for the right-back, with injuries elsewhere in the squad for the Bundesliga outfit seemingly creating the opportunity for him to make his first league start of the season after the international break.

However, that possibility could now be in doubt, after the 25-year-old suffered an injury of his own during a training session for Switzerland.

The Leeds loanee departed his nation’s training camp on Sunday, after suffering from “severe pain” for large parts of the week due to a blow to his foot, according to Bild.

Schmidt is set to undergo medical tests imminently over the “next few days,” and it is currently unclear how long he will be on the sidelines for.

Leeds need Isaac Schmidt to perform during loan spell to seal permanent exit

Leeds were desperate to offload Schmidt over the summer, but were ultimately only able to secure a loan exit for him.

He simply hasn’t worked out as a signing at all, and with that in mind, they will surely be hoping to oversee a permanent departure either in January or in the next summer transfer window.

However, Werder Bremen are unlikely to be keen to do permanent business for Schmidt if he is unable to break into their team.

It has already become pretty clear that he has no future at Leeds, but injury issues like this will still be a concern because it could easily result in them being stuck with a player who is severely out of favour in the long term.
